Yes, it is based on a true story. The events that inspired 'The Watcher' took place in a real house in New Jersey, where the homeowners received disturbing letters from someone calling themselves 'The Watcher'.
Yes, 'The Watcher' in New Jersey is based on a true story. It involves a family who received creepy letters from an anonymous person known as 'The Watcher' after moving into their new home in Westfield, New Jersey.

The identity of 'The Watcher' in the New Jersey story remains unknown. There were speculations, but no one was ever proven to be the person behind those creepy letters.
The New Jersey Devil is a legendary creature in folklore. It's said to be a strange and fearsome being with various descriptions. Some stories describe it as having wings, a horse-like head, and a forked tail.
